### Step 4 — Port the relevance tuning knobs

Quick heads-up before you cut the release: the old Quillbrook search stack buried its relevance weights in three different YAML files, and the new Ternwood engine wants them all in one place. We've already merged the field boosts, freshness decay, and phrase-match bonus into a single profile, so you don't need to chase anything down. Just make sure the staging index rebuild finishes before flipping traffic. For the cutover, apply the consolidated values below.

settings of fafog-haduf:
ZORIX_PIN=4648
ZORIX_METRICS_HOST=metrics.zorix.paliqsys.corp
ZORIX_LOG_LEVEL=info
ZORIX_TENANT=druix

Welcome to Fenwick & Harrow. Our canteen on the ground floor of Aldercroft Place is shared with our neighbours at Tollvane Analytics, and their staff may enter through the east doors between 11:30 and 14:00. Please queue at either till; payment is by staff card only. Tables by the atrium are unreserved. Out of hours, the canteen is locked and accessible only to Fenwick & Harrow staff. To enter outside service times, use the door code shown below.

staff pass of kawip-hawef = bdg-QLP-2

The new layout pass in GraphLoom resolves the overlap issues plugin nodes were causing, but it's sensitive to edge density. Plugin authors should not override the force parameters unless their graphs exceed a few thousand nodes, since the renderer assumes these defaults. The constants the layout engine currently ships with are listed below.

tuning table, yajog-yahof:
BUDGETS = {
    "lamvan": 303,
    "wenox": 460,
    "fenvan": 525,
}

## 4.2.1

- Health checks for the Larkmount API pool behind the Tidegate load balancer now use a dedicated /status endpoint instead of the login page.
- Check interval dropped to 10s; unhealthy nodes drain in under a minute.
- Support impact: fewer false 502 alerts during deploys. Escalate any lingering flaps to the owner listed below.

named custodian: Brivan Eliath Quenox Frador